Abstract

The utility model belongs to the technical field of an appliance for automobile parts, and particularly relates to a shifting fork. The shifting fork comprises a body, wherein one side of the body is in a convex arc-shaped surface, an arc concave surface is formed in the middle of the front end of the body, and circular arc transition is performed between the arc concave surface and the front end of the body; the rear end of the body is connected with a cylinder, a through hole is formed in the axial direction of the cylinder, the outside part of the cylinder is connected with a connecting piece, and a clamping slot is formed in one side of the connecting piece. The shifting fork provided by the utility model is simple in structure, is capable of reducing the stress received by the shifting fork well, greatly enhancing the using strength, and prolonging the service life.

Background technique
Shift fork is the part belonging in auto parts and components, be mainly to promote sliding gear, have an annular groove shift fork just to ride in this annular groove on sliding gear, in the time that driver promotes speed change lever, speed change lever drives declutch shift shaft, declutch shift shaft drives shift fork, reaches gear shift thereby shift fork promotes again gear.Material nonhomogeneous hardness between shift fork and sliding gear is larger, long-time rubbing contact, and when poor in road conditions especially and Vehicular shift, shift fork driven gear, causes shift fork inordinate wear for a long time.The unreasonable design of shift fork also can make shift fork stressed unreasonable, and shift fork occurs crackle from stress raiser, and prolonged exercise can rupture.
